What Types of Sacred Rituals Do Hyderabad Priests Perform?
Hyderabad's diverse Hindu community requires experienced priests for sacred rituals spanning the full arc of life — from birth to death and every milestone in between. The most frequently booked ceremonies include: Vivah Sanskar (wedding rituals including saptapadi, kanyadaan, and mangalsutra dharana), Griha Pravesh (housewarming with Vastu puja and Ganapati sthapana), Namkaran (naming ceremony typically on the 11th or 12th day), Annaprashana (first rice-feeding ceremony), Upanayana or Munja (sacred thread ceremony), Satyanarayan Katha, Ganesh Chaturthi puja, and Shraddh or Pitru Tarpan rites. Professional pooja conductors in Hyderabad are also regularly engaged for office inaugurations, shop openings (Dukaan Puja), and vehicle pujas. Each of these ceremonies demands a different level of Sanskrit-trained pujari services — some, like a simple Lakshmi puja, may take 45 minutes; a full south-Indian Brahmin wedding can extend across two days with multiple sub-rituals. How Much Does Hiring Experienced Priests for Sacred Rituals Cost in Hyderabad?
Pricing for experienced priests for sacred rituals in Hyderabad varies based on ritual complexity, priest seniority, duration, and whether religious ceremony samagri (the complete set of puja items) is bundled in the package. For a short home puja such as Satyanarayan Katha or Ganesh Puja, fees typically range from ₹2,500 to ₹6,000. A namkaran or annaprashana ceremony usually falls between ₹4,000 and ₹9,000. Upanayana and griha pravesh ceremonies, which involve more elaborate rituals and longer durations, are commonly priced from ₹8,000 to ₹18,000. Full wedding packages with Hindu ceremony pandits in Hyderabad — covering muhurat calculation, all sub-rituals, and sometimes post-wedding homa — range from ₹15,000 to ₹40,000 or more for premium experienced priests. Keep in mind that auspicious muhurat timing consultations may be priced separately at ₹500–₹2,000. If you are supplying your own samagri, clarify this upfront to avoid duplication. Travel charges apply for venues beyond 20 km from the priest's base location — typically ₹200–₹800 extra within Greater Hyderabad. Always request an itemised quote so there are no surprises on the day. Vedic Ritual Specialists vs General Pandits: What Is the Difference?
Not every priest who performs a puja is equally equipped for every ceremony. Understanding this distinction helps families make a far better choice. A general pandit is typically comfortable with everyday household pujas — Lakshmi puja, Ganesh puja, graha shanti — and can handle these efficiently and affordably. Vedic ritual specialists, by contrast, have undergone years of gurukul or institutional training in Vedic recitation, yagna vidhana, and specific agamic traditions. They are the right choice for once-in-a-lifetime ceremonies like Upanayana, Vivah Homa, or complex Navagraha Shanti rituals where scriptural precision carries real weight. Sanskrit-trained pujari services sit in a middle tier: these priests have formal Sanskrit training, can recite Vedic hymns with correct swaras (tonal inflections), and are ideal for ceremonies that demand both accuracy and accessibility for a modern audience. What is the typical duration of a namkaran ceremony with a pandit?
A namkaran ceremony conducted by a Sanskrit-trained pujari typically lasts between 45 minutes and 90 minutes. The ceremony includes Ganapati puja, Punyaha vachanam, Naamakarana vidhi, and blessings for the child. If the family requests additional rituals like Jatakarma or Nishkramana alongside the naming ceremony, it can extend to two hours. Priests usually advise families to have all family members ready 15 minutes before the muhurat begins to avoid time pressure.
Is there a difference between a pujari and a pandit?
In common Hyderabad usage, both terms are used interchangeably, but there is a subtle distinction. A pujari is primarily a temple priest responsible for daily deity worship (archana, abhisheka), while a pandit is a learned scholar-priest who performs household and life-event ceremonies (samskaras). Vedic ritual specialists may hold both roles. For personal ceremonies like weddings or griha pravesh, you want a pandit with samskara-vidhi training rather than a pujari whose primary training is in temple rituals.
How much does a full South Indian wedding ceremony cost with a pandit in Hyderabad?
A full South Indian Hindu wedding ceremony — covering muhurat calculation, Nandi, Ganapati puja, Kashi Yatra, kanyadaan, saptapadi, mangalsutra dharana, and Aashirvad — typically costs between ₹18,000 and ₹40,000 for experienced priests for sacred rituals in Hyderabad. This range depends on the priest's seniority, whether a second pandit assists (required for some rituals), and if samagri is included. Premium Vedic ritual specialists for large kalyana mandapam events may charge higher fees.
What languages do Hyderabad pandits recite mantras in?
Mantras are always recited in Sanskrit, as this is the sacred language of Vedic tradition. However, experienced Hindu ceremony pandits in Hyderabad also explain the meaning and sequence of rituals in Telugu, Hindi, or Tamil based on the family's preference. This bilingual approach — Sanskrit for the sacred recitation, regional language for the explanation — greatly enhances the spiritual ceremony experience for modern families who want to participate meaningfully rather than simply observe.

What samagri is typically needed for a griha pravesh puja in Hyderabad?
A standard griha pravesh puja requires Ganapati idol or photo, coconut, turmeric, kumkum, flowers (especially marigold and mango leaves), raw rice, ghee, camphor, agarbatti, and specific homa samagri items like sesame seeds, barley, and wooden sticks. The exact list varies by regional tradition and priest. Can a pandit perform a shraddh or pitru tarpan ceremony at my Hyderabad home?
Yes. Sanskrit-trained pujari services available through Happiffie in Hyderabad include Shraddh, Pitru Tarpan, and Mahalaya Amavasya ceremonies at home. These are typically conducted in the morning and require specific samagri including black sesame, kusha grass, and water from a sacred source. Priests experienced in these rites are familiar with the Apastamba or Bodhayana sutra traditions common among Telugu Brahmin families in Hyderabad.
What is the average duration of a griha pravesh ceremony in Hyderabad?
A griha pravesh ceremony conducted by experienced priests for sacred rituals in Hyderabad typically lasts between 1.5 and 3 hours. This includes Ganapati puja, Punyaha vachanam, Vastu Shanti homa, and the formal entry ritual. If additional pujas like Navagraha Shanti or Sudarshana Homa are added, the ceremony can extend to 4 hours. Discuss the full ritual list with your priest during booking to align expectations and plan the day's schedule accordingly.
